Smart Clothes Smart clothes are clothes that are made of fabric but have many sensors in them that check your vital signs every second. If any danger is detected, it will alert you so that you can get to a doctor or hospital if needed. If you get cold, it has a sensor that is solar powered to warm you back up. They also have a work jacket that will record meeting for you to listen to later. They also have clothes for night time that has a light. They have features that will always make you smell good, alert you when you drink more than average, and controls the temperature of your body so that you don’t sweat while you’re working out or dancing.

Future Technology in Cars Potential future cars include new energy sources and materials, which are being developed to make cars more energy efficient and less polluting. As gas prices are rising, the future of cars is leaning towards fuel efficiency. Hybrid vehicles are cars that use two or more power sources to move the vehicle, which combine internal combustion engine and one or more electric motors. Electric vehicles are cars that use one or more electric motors or traction motors for propulsion. Fuel cell vehicles are vehicles with a device that converts chemical energy from a fuel into electricity through a chemical reaction with oxygen or another oxidizing agent.

Future Technology in Agriculture Vertical Farming or sky farming is a theoretical form of agriculture which can be done in urban high-rises. Food such as vegetables, fruit, fish, and even live-stock can be raised by using greenhouse growing methods. Vertical farming has many advantages such as preventing deforestation. By producing food in the city there will be less pollution caused by transporting food from long distances.
